VPN连接后无法上网?常见原因与解决方案详解

VPN软件 2026-04-18 09:58:32 4 0

作为一名网络工程师,我经常遇到用户反馈“连接了VPN之后无法上网”的问题,这个问题看似简单,实则可能涉及多个层面的网络配置、安全策略或服务异常,本文将从技术角度出发,系统分析导致该问题的常见原因,并提供实用的排查步骤和解决方法。

需要明确的是,VPN(虚拟私人网络)的作用是加密用户与远程服务器之间的通信通道,从而实现数据传输的安全性和隐私保护,但一旦连接失败或配置不当,不仅无法访问目标资源,甚至可能导致本地网络中断,出现“连不上网”的现象。

常见原因一:DNS解析异常
很多用户在连接某些类型的VPN(尤其是OpenVPN或WireGuard)时,会发现虽然连接成功,但网页打不开、应用无法加载内容,这通常是因为VPN客户端自动更改了系统的DNS设置,而新的DNS服务器无法正确解析域名,一些免费或第三方VPN服务商使用的DNS地址可能被墙或延迟过高,解决方法是手动切换回可靠的公共DNS,如Google DNS(8.8.8.8 和 8.8.4.4)或阿里云DNS(223.5.5.5),并在Windows或Mac的网络设置中修改IPv4 DNS配置。

常见原因二:路由表冲突
当本地网络和VPN网络使用相同的IP段时(比如两者都用192.168.1.x子网),会出现路由冲突,导致流量无法正确转发,这种情况常出现在企业级或自建OpenVPN服务器环境中,可以通过命令行工具(如Windows的route print或Linux的ip route show)查看当前路由表,确认是否有重复或错误的静态路由,解决办法是调整本地网络或VPN服务器的子网掩码,避免IP地址重叠。

常见原因三:防火墙或杀毒软件拦截
部分安全软件(如Windows Defender、卡巴斯基、火绒等)会把VPN连接识别为潜在威胁,从而阻止其建立隧道或访问互联网,建议暂时关闭防火墙测试是否恢复正常,若能恢复,则需将相关VPN客户端程序添加到白名单中。

常见原因四:ISP限速或封禁
国内部分地区运营商对非标准端口(如OpenVPN默认的UDP 1194)进行深度包检测(DPI),可能会限制或丢弃加密流量,此时即使连接成功,也无法访问公网,可以尝试更换协议(如TCP模式)、端口号(如443),或使用更隐蔽的协议(如Shadowsocks、V2Ray等)。

也是最容易被忽视的一点:检查是否启用了“仅通过VPN访问互联网”选项(即Split Tunneling关闭),如果该功能被启用,所有流量都会强制走VPN链路,一旦VPN服务器异常,整个网络就会瘫痪。


“连接VPN后无法上网”是一个典型的多因素故障,需逐层排查——先看DNS、再查路由、然后验证防火墙和ISP策略,作为网络工程师,我建议用户在使用前了解所选VPN的服务质量、支持协议和日志记录能力,必要时可联系技术支持获取详细诊断信息,保持良好的网络习惯和基础技能,才能在复杂环境中快速定位并解决问题。

VPN连接后无法上网?常见原因与解决方案详解

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

如果没有特点说明,本站所有内容均由半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速原创,转载请注明出处!